Larry's Glass Co in East Weymouth

Write your review of Larry's Glass Co
Select your star rating
Please select your star rating
Your review must be longer than 15 characters
Nearby similar companies
3 mi
Giant Glass Inc
1411 Main St
South Weymouth, MA 02190
3.8 mi
Acme Glass
1420 Bedford St
Abington, MA 02351
5.3 mi
Pilkington North America Inc
37 Teed Dr # A
Randolph, MA 02368
7.2 mi
James Glass Co
14 Hanover St # 2
Hanover, MA 02339